Teacher’s Staffroom

by Mayowa aged 10

Have you ever wondered what is in the teacher’s staffroom,
if they’re sneaking in chocolate bars or dancing with a broom,
well hurry, the door is open, let’s take a peek.

Mrs Ford is on duty but she’s fast asleep,
there’s a key on the table what is it for?
Maybe it’s for the lock on that cupboard door,
looking inside treats galore,
wait, is that Tom’s sweet box,
the one he was crying for?

I can hear noises, hide behind the door,
the teacher’s cry, “It’s lunchtime,
this is what we’ve been waiting for.”
Sneak quietly out
behind the teachers’ backs

You had better run
Mrs Ford is about to wake up.
